2. Technical Foundations: The Engine Behind the Fire

Underpinning Pirots 4’s immersive destruction are three core technical pillars: real-time physics integration, responsive AI behaviors, and the delicate balance between chaos and control. These systems ensure that every collapse feels both impactful and coherent.

Real-time physics engines simulate material properties—wood splinters, concrete shatters, metal bends—creating tactile feedback that grounds destruction in physical reality. When combined with responsive AI, destruction patterns adapt dynamically: enemies may exploit collapsing debris or avoid unstable zones, enhancing strategic depth.

AI behaviors evolve with player actions, recognizing and reacting to destruction cycles. A building’s collapse path might shift mid-session if AI detects a player’s tactical approach, maintaining tension and unpredictability. This synergy between physics and AI transforms destruction from a visual event into a strategic battlefield.

2.1 Real-Time Physics Integration and Immersion

Pirots 4 leverages advanced real-time physics to simulate destruction with remarkable fidelity. Each material deforms, fractures, and falls according to physics laws tuned for responsiveness and realism. This precision ensures that player actions—whether a controlled demolition or a chaotic explosion—carry weight and believability.

Physics Parameter Impact on Gameplay
Material Fracture Points Enables predictable yet varied breakages, enhancing player control and immersion
Collision Response Ensures realistic interactions between falling debris and environment, reinforcing physical logic
Force Propagation Distributes destruction effects logically, preventing unnatural or jarring collapses

2.2 Responsive AI Behaviors in Destruction Contexts

AI in Pirots 4 adapts intelligently to player destruction patterns. Machine learning models trained on player behavior identify trends—such as preferred collapse zones or timing—and adjust enemy tactics accordingly. This creates a feedback loop where the environment evolves in response to player agency.

For example, if a player repeatedly triggers collapses in a narrow corridor, AI can reinforce that area with unstable structures or deploy distractions, increasing challenge and immersion. This adaptive intelligence turns destruction from a static event into a dynamic, evolving experience.

2.3 Chaos vs. Control in Destructible Environments

The game masterfully balances chaotic destruction with intentional control. While physics and AI introduce unpredictability—such as cascading collapses or unexpected debris paths—core structural integrity remains consistent enough to preserve purpose and progression.

This balance ensures that destruction feels impactful without becoming arbitrary. Players retain a sense of mastery, knowing collapse sequences follow logical physics, even as they surprise with timing and pattern shifts. This duality sustains engagement by merging surprise with coherence.
